DESCRIPTION OF OUR T-BALL LEAGUE
T-Ball: A program recommended for 4, 5, and 6 year olds to teach the fundamentals of hitting and fielding. All batters will hit the ball from a batting tee which is adjusted to a height that allows the batter to swing level. All rostered players present for the game bat in order, whether playing defensively or not. Each player plays a minimum of two innings defensively An adult coach is stationed beyond the infielders in order to provide instruction to all defensive players. The primary goal is to begin to instruct young players in the fundamentals of baseball in a supportive team environment.

GENERAL INFORMATION ABOUT OUR T-BALL LEAGUE
At this level players begin to play using a regular baseball. All players will play on both offense and defense each inning. Coaches will remain on the field to offer instruction throughout the game on both offense and defense. At the end of each spring season each player in T-Ball will receive a trophy. We do have an All-Star team for this level that is made up of the best players from each team. This team will travel to other parks as well as our own as they play against other local leagues.
